Salers Liqueur de Gentiane (Gentian)

Created by Alfred Labounoux in 1885, the Salers Gentian recipe is made from gentian roots cultivated in sustainable agriculture. After distillations and macerations, the distillate is placed in oak barrels for more than 3 years. Perfect in a Negroni! Tasting Notes: Nose: Elegant and typical of gentian with notes of the soil. Palate: All the typicality of gentian on the palate.

Giffard Piment D'Espelette (Chili) Premium Liqueur

France's No.1 Syrups and Liqueurs Tasting Notes: Lustrous gold, with a wonderfully sharp fragrant note of fresh and dried chilli. Sweet vegetal notes balance a fiery spice, with a hint of Madagascan vanilla, smoked black tea leaves, and a rich chilli pepper kick. History: Piment D'Espelette is made in France by a fifth generation family established 1885. Traditional maceration using the only French spice with a Designation of Origin Protection (DPO) and 100% pure French sugar beet. Finished with Martinique Rhum Agricole and a selection of spices. No preservatives added. Great For: Perfect on the rocks as a digestif, or in high class mixed drinks and cocktails. Use in place of triple sec to add a fiery kick to your margaritas. Rated 5 Stars on the renowned Difford's Guide.

Gabriel Boudier Liqueur De Chataigne (Chestnut)

During the tasting of Gabriel Boudier's Chestnut Liqueur, you’ll discover a harmonious blend of flavours. AROMA: A rich nose of fresh chestnut, elevated by soft notes of vanilla and a delicate hint of honey. PALATE: A smooth, velvety opening leads to an indulgent burst of chestnut flavour. Honey brings roundness, while vanilla delivers a soft and elegant finish. Usage This liqueur adds a woody and sweet twist to classic cocktails, or can be enjoyed on its own to warm up winter evenings. It shines in a Chestnut Manhattan, a reimagined Old Fashioned, or simply served over ice.

Tempus Fugit Creme de Banane

Based on historical recipes, Tempus Fugit Crème de Banane offers authentic flavours and aromas that can often be lost in modern banana liqueurs. Perfectly matured bananas are distilled in small batches to extract their full flavour, lending an amber golden colour from the fully ripe fruit. No artificial colours or flavours are added. The banana liqueur is made naturally from extracts and distillation of bananas.
